Output 65963216befaf6741cfcdf39e63b75483fe2018e45bb0239a2aec3e58c45c3b4:0

value
46758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1743d0d645ebdb54746909442e1d3ff1bc28ed56 OP_EQUALVERIFY OP_CHECKSIG
address
1381nLPqGZ87NMz3iMraye4HWDgoDqAgg5
transaction
65963216befaf6741cfcdf39e63b75483fe2018e45bb0239a2aec3e58c45c3b4
spent
true